Thats the point, the COWS are acting (and saying) as though the whole ord is being re-written an that is not the case, by any means. Just the unbalanced/draconian staging permit process will be changed.
All other provisions stay in place while I still question the validity/legality of the written permission for un-posted land I am not going to quibble.

As I have said before I don't like to ride on my property circles or otherwise and love to go on long rides, our place is near a blm area and is also on non CSA roads, before the ord my friends/family and I would stage at our place and ride the roads to one destination or the other. (heck until the ord we did not even have a track on our property and would every once in while just take the kids on short to medium rides) most times just in small groups (4 to 5) sometimes larger (10-15) always on well used roads and trails, one of my favorite rides was through to Big Bear about 50 miles one way the transition from desert to forest is an amazing site.

Then the ord happened and all that had to stop because even though we had no intention of riding around/loitering in the neighborhood I had to jump through hoops and pay an unreasonable fee so code enforcement could watch us and have our location published on the internet so any local OHV hater could call and complain because we rode by,or worse make false complaints for our area.

Most of us work hard and have many ways of relaxing, one of my ways is to ride the desert, but I don't do it all the time, and it is not always a holiday weekend. Even before the ord there have been weeks at a time when I never saw a motorcycle or other OHV. It seems the problem was very over exaggerated by a very small but vocal group.

The claims by that small group that they had no ord in place in the instance of a real OHV problem is false. Ordinance 3096 had nearly the same wording minus the unreasonable staging permit and written permission on unposted land, had that been enforced there would be less problems, I say less problems because that small vocal group will always complain because their agenda is not to coexist or get along with anything they deem not worthy.

Ordinance 3973… In case you didn’t know, you can forget all the COW Bull. The truth is a matter of record.

The Supervisors expressed reservations about the workability of OHV Ordinance #3973 at its adoption hearing over three years ago. But, they heard no opposition at that time so they agreed to give it a one year trial to see how it would fly! (Video available from Clerk of the Board)

One year later the ordinance was re-evaluated. This time there was plenty of opposition. Hundreds of families attended the re-visiting and by that time, thousands of letters, phone calls and petitions had been received asking the Board to re-consider a discriminatory and likely unconstitutional requirement.

Among their concerns was the condition that one must obtain permission from the government, a month in advance, if anyone wants to use even one OHV on their own property when more than nine people are present. I’m serious and the rule is in fact so poorly written that it could also result in everyone present, being cited. (See Ordinance #3973)

All the County Supervisors agreed that the staging permit requirement was not reasonable and something should be done. Supervisors Mitzelfelt and Hansberger agreed to study the issue and make a recommendation. (See video on Co. website)

Supervisors Mitzelfelt and Derry (Hansberger’s successor) are to be commended for now honoring this standing commitment.

It is obvious to them that with only ten (10) customers, in three and a half years, a rule that interferes with a family’s right to peacefully assemble on there own land has had nothing to do with any success attributed to the ordinance and cannot be justified.

Supervisors Mitzelfelt and Derry will present their recommendation to repeal the staging permit portion of the ordinance to the rest of the Board… soon.
